Class SpinnakerCapture#

Namespace: Aeon.Video
Assembly: Aeon.Video.dll

public class SpinnakerCapture : SpinnakerCapture

Inheritance#

object ← Source<SpinnakerDataFrame> ← SpinnakerCapture ← SpinnakerCapture

Derived#

AeonCapture

Inherited Members#

SpinnakerCapture.Configure(IManagedCamera), SpinnakerCapture.Generate(), SpinnakerCapture.Generate<TSource>(IObservable<TSource>), SpinnakerCapture.Index, SpinnakerCapture.SerialNumber, SpinnakerCapture.ColorProcessing, Source<SpinnakerDataFrame>.Generate(), object.ToString(), object.Equals(object), object.Equals(object, object), object.ReferenceEquals(object, object), object.GetHashCode(), object.GetType(), object.MemberwiseClone()

Constructors#

SpinnakerCapture()#

public SpinnakerCapture()

Properties#

Binning#

public int Binning { get; set; }

Property Value#

int

ExposureTime#

public double ExposureTime { get; set; }

Property Value#

double

Gain#

public double Gain { get; set; }

Property Value#

double

Methods#

Configure(IManagedCamera)#

protected override void Configure(IManagedCamera camera)

Parameters#

camera IManagedCamera

Generate<TPayload>(IObservable<Timestamped<TPayload>>)#

public IObservable<Timestamped<VideoDataFrame>> Generate<TPayload>(IObservable<Timestamped<TPayload>> source)

Parameters#

source IObservable<Timestamped<TPayload>>

Returns#

IObservable<Timestamped<VideoDataFrame>>

Type Parameters#

TPayload